Begini Howard Residency — Enrollment Agreement (Individual)
Between BHR LLC (“BHR”), a Vermont limited liability company, and the undersigned (“Participant”), effective the date signed below. Term: six (6) months from the cohort start date stated on BHR’s invoice. Cohorts are limited to ten (10) new seats per month across all tiers; a Prime-tier enrollment occupies two seats. BHR delivers the Residency in partnership with BHPE LLC (“BHPE”), an active government contractor and a separate company.
1. Core deliverables (both paths). Tuition buys, and BHR guarantees: (a) the Residency curriculum — federal and state solicitation analysis, vendor identification and outreach, pricing, and quote/proposal assembly; (b) a guaranteed seat in the Live-Bid Practicum, working real, open solicitations on BHPE’s live pipeline under principal supervision — no fewer than three (3) live opportunities, selection at BHR’s discretion; (c) submission handled for Participant: until Participant’s first Covered Award, submission to the customer is performed exclusively by BHPE’s team; after that first award, the curriculum adds submission practice and contract-execution training; (d) a capstone reviewed by program principals; and (e) upon completion in good standing and eligibility under Section 6, the opportunity to execute BHPE’s Associate Agreement at no cost — a separate agreement with a separate company, on its own terms.
2. Path selection (choose one). ☐ Earn-Back ☐ Leverage
Earn-Back (all-or-nothing). No profit share applies to work performed during the Term; Participant’s path to the Associate commission is BHPE’s Associate Agreement at completion in good standing (or upon switching to Leverage). THE CHALLENGE: submit 100 Qualifying Quotes within the Term and BHR rebates 100% of tuition ($25,000) within fifteen (15) days of the 100th. Fewer than 100 Qualifying Quotes — even 99 — earns no rebate in any amount. This is a tuition rebate, not wages or compensation. Initials: ________
A Qualifying Quote is a quote that meets all of the following: (i) prepared by Participant on an open federal or state opportunity claimed by Participant in the shared tracker — one participant per solicitation, first claim controls; (ii) responsive to the solicitation’s requirements; (iii) total quoted value of at least $20,000; (iv) delivered to the submission desk at least twenty-four (24) hours before the solicitation’s due date/time; and (v) submitted by the desk to the customer under BHPE’s name — or counted under the desk-failure rule below.
For on-time packages, the desk — within two (2) business days of receipt or before the solicitation deadline, whichever comes first — does one of two things: submits the package under BHPE’s name (it counts) or returns it with written reasons (it does not count; Participant may revise and resubmit without limit, subject to the same deadlines — earlier delivery leaves room to clarify, fix, and resubmit before the deadline). An on-time package that is neither submitted nor returned with written reasons before the solicitation deadline counts as a Qualifying Quote. Packages received less than twenty-four (24) hours before the due date/time may be handled at the desk’s discretion but carry no commitments and no count protection. A live shared tracker, visible to Participant at all times, is the official record of claims, package receipt times, desk actions, and the quote count.
BHR will maintain an opportunity pool refreshed on business days with open opportunities reasonably capable of meeting the Qualifying-Quote criteria; if for any period the pool lacks claimable opportunities meeting those criteria, the 100-quote quota prorates for that period. Participant may switch from Earn-Back to Leverage at any time by written election. The election is irrevocable and ends the Challenge — after switching, no rebate is available in any amount. Leverage benefits begin within five (5) business days of the election and run for the remainder of the Term, including eligibility to execute BHPE’s Associate Agreement upon switching. Switching from Leverage to Earn-Back is not permitted. Documented medical incapacity extends the Term day-for-day, up to sixty (60) days.
Leverage. BHR provides for the Term: (a) a dedicated virtual assistant supporting Participant’s Residency work (20 hours/week); (b) a premium AI research-and-drafting tool subscription; and (c) full access to the opportunity pool from day one. The program goal — a goal, not a commitment or guarantee by either party — is one hundred (100) submitted proposals during the Term. Participant may execute BHPE’s Associate Agreement (20% of Gross Profit on Covered Awards, per its terms) at enrollment.
3. Not a job. The Residency is education and supervised practice — not employment, job placement, a franchise, or an investment. Neither BHR nor BHPE guarantees any income, commission, contract award, or business result. The Earn-Back rebate depends entirely on Participant completing the Challenge.
4. Tuition. $25,000 USD, paid to BHR in a single transaction by wire or ACH before Residency access begins. Earn-Back tuition is held in reserve until the Challenge resolves.
5. NO REFUNDS. All tuition payments are final and non-refundable upon execution of this Agreement. Sole exceptions: a refund required by applicable law, or BHR’s failure to commence the cohort within thirty (30) days of the stated start date, in which case Participant may request a full refund. The Earn-Back rebate is earned under the Earn-Back path and is not a refund. Initials: ________
6. Completion and eligibility. The Residency is not offered to residents of Oklahoma. “Completion in good standing” means finishing the capstone and syllabus deliverables with no material violation of Section 7. Associate Agreement eligibility additionally requires: U.S. work authorization; not suspended, debarred, or proposed for debarment in SAM.gov; completed IRS W-9. BHPE’s Associate Agreement is free, and available without the Residency to applicants with equivalent experience via BHPE’s application.
7. Conduct. Participant will keep confidential all solicitation documents, agency communications, pricing, vendor quotes, and Residency materials (BHR and BHPE property, licensed for personal use only); will not contact any agency, official, vendor, or subcontractor in BHR’s or BHPE’s name without prior written approval — a Desk Account issued under BHPE’s Desk Email Policy carries standing approval for vendor pricing inquiries, strictly within that policy’s scope; everything else still requires approval in each instance; and will comply with all applicable law, including the Procurement Integrity Act. Material violation permits removal without refund and voids the unearned rebate.

9. Disputes, liability, general. Vermont law governs. Written notice and a thirty (30)-day informal-resolution window precede any claim. Except for small-claims matters, any dispute arising from or relating to this Agreement — including this Section’s scope or enforceability — is resolved by binding individual arbitration in Chittenden County, Vermont under AAA rules; both parties waive class actions and jury trial. Claims must be brought within one (1) year of accrual, where permitted by law. BHR’s total liability is capped at tuition actually paid, less any rebate paid; no consequential, incidental, or punitive damages — each limit applying except where prohibited by law. Entire agreement; unenforceable provisions severed.
